- The Israeli Army has been authorised to demolish hundreds
of houses in the southern Gaza Strip city of Rafah, where five soldiers
were killed earlier this week.
-
- Israeli Prime Minister Ariel Sharon gave the Army the
green light to destroy hundreds of houses and widen the 'Philadelphi' route,
a buffer zone which runs along the Israeli-controlled border with Egypt.
-
- The first houses to be destroyed will be empty buildings.
An official from Mr Sharon's office described the action as a legitimate
defensive measure.
